第三代移动通信技术支持分层小区结构(HCS),宽带CDMA的载波可引进一种被称为“移动辅助异频越区切换(MAIFHO)”的新切换机制,使其能够支持分层小区结构。这样,移动台可以扫描多个码分多址载波,使得移动系统可在热点地区部署微小区。在蜂窝移动通信网中,切换是保证移动用户在移动状态下实现不间断通信越区切换;切换也是为了在移动台与网络之间保持一个可以接受的通信质量,防止通信中断,这是适应移动衰落信道特性的必不可少的措施。特别是由网络发起的切换,其目的是为了平衡服务区内各小区的业务量,降低高用户小区的呼损率的有力措施。切换可以优化无线资源(频率、时隙、码)的使用;还可以及时减小移动台的功率消耗和对全局的干扰电平的限制。
